Chapter 162 Apex of a Province!
The three of them spoke in unison, their voices reverberating through the sky, amplified by their vigorous True Qi.
The dilapidated mountain temple, already exposed on all sides, seemed on the verge of collapse, with dust cascading down from the roof and walls.
It was a grand display of power.
First came the sound, then the sight of them.
Among the three, one approached wielding a long sword, his green robes fluttering in the wind. His face was like polished jade, and his three-foot-long beard shimmered with a purple light.
Another stood nine feet tall, a giant among men. His rugged face was scarred, and his bare upper body revealed more gruesome marks. His hands were far larger than those of ordinary people.
The last one, clad in flowing white robes and carrying a long sword on his back, seemed ready to take flight on the night wind.
All three possessed extraordinary bearing and charisma, causing Li Feibai and the others to tremble and turn ashen.
"Feng Zhenzong, Dong Tianyou, Yun Tang..."
Yuan San swayed on his feet, as if hearing these names had conjured a ghost.
He recognized the man in green robes as Feng Zhenzong, the hulking giant as Yun Tang, and the white-robed swordsman as Dong Tianyou.
All three were among the most formidable experts in Feng Province, rumored to be innate grandmasters who had cultivated their Qi Channels for many years.
Ordinary martial artists considered themselves elites, but they were dwarfed by these three masters, let alone facing them directly.
Instantly, the three wanted to prostrate themselves.
These were grandmasters they would never even dream of meeting!
"The Earthly List, the second on the Earthly List..."
Li Feihong's expression was grim, as she suddenly realized who this Mr. An, ranked second on the Earthly List, was.
Although the Weaponry Index had gained popularity under the Six Doors' promotion, it had only been a little over a month, and its reach was not yet universal, especially since the three of them had been planning a major event for several months.
But she seemed to have heard people talk about it before...
"Three Qi Channels..."
Tie Shan's face tightened slightly.
In the past month, he had followed An Qisheng across most of Feng Province, 'visiting' dozens of martial arts sects and gangs. Some had treated them well, while others had secretly informed the Six Doors.
Some had even poisoned them and gathered experts to ambush them.
But being confronted by three Qi Channel masters simultaneously still made him feel a little nervous.
"What do you seek from me?"
Beside the bonfire, An Qisheng lazily raised his eyelids and asked casually.
Although he had guessed that fame and fortune were great temptations for the people of this world.
But he was still slightly surprised that these three grandmasters, who had cultivated their Qi Channels and were renowned throughout the province, were so easily swayed.
His gaze swept over the three.
Their True Qi was vast and surging, their physiques incredibly strong. They blocked the entrance, and under the pressure of their aura, even the surrounding night wind seemed to have ceased blowing.
They were indeed experts.
"Mr. An has caused quite a stir in Feng Province. How could we three, as local hosts, not come and pay our respects?"
The night wind was slight, but Feng Zhenzong's green robes fluttered, his entire body already filled with surging True Qi.
Although he disagreed with the imperial court's ranking of An Qisheng as second on the Earthly List, he had still killed Xue Chaoyang and Tuoba Chongguang, so he naturally dared not be careless.
"I've heard that Mr. An has obtained divine skills. Yun seeks to test his mettle and has come uninvited."
Yun Tang stood with his hands clasped behind his back, his aura as imposing as a mountain.
His eyes were bright, like burning flames, and he was extremely interested in An Qisheng.
He had heard about the emergence of the Soul-Seizing Demonic Art several months ago, but after condensing his Qi Channels, it was impossible to change his cultivation method, so he had little interest in it.
It was only after hearing the news of Xue Chaoyang and the other's deaths that his interest was piqued.
"They two were afraid and insisted on dragging me along, so I had no choice but to come."
Dong Tianyou smiled slightly, his attitude gentle.
As they spoke, the three also sized up An Qisheng through the gaping doorway.
They found his physique loose and unkempt, lacking both Qi and blood, and seemingly devoid of inner strength or True Qi. If they hadn't already confirmed his identity, they would have thought he was just a senile old Taoist.
Tie Shan quietly introduced the three men's information to An Qisheng.
As a constable dispatched to Feng Province by the Six Doors, he was naturally well-versed in the details of Feng Province's many experts.
These three could be considered the strongest in Feng Province.
Even when Ming Tang was in charge, backed by the imperial court, he was quite wary of these three.
"So what if you've seen me?"
An Qisheng lowered his eyelids and replied indifferently.
He was delighted that so many experts had come to his door. No matter their purpose, they would always add bricks and tiles to his martial arts library.
Any Qi Channel master would surely possess a complete set of martial arts, and there might even be surprises.
It was far more rewarding than visiting each sect one by one.
"Mr. An's method of concealing his Qi, blood, and inner strength is indeed extraordinary."
Feng Zhenzong said calmly:
"But relying on this method alone to rank second on the Earthly List, on par with the Hero King, I'm afraid is not enough."
Not only Feng Zhenzong, but Yun Tang and the others also felt somewhat aggrieved by this.
Although they didn't care about a list compiled by the imperial court, as the list spread, those who were not included felt somewhat uncomfortable.
Not to mention the world, but even within the Great Feng Dynasty, there were more than seventy-two people who had cultivated their Qi Channels.
They were all Qi Channel masters, so why were you stronger than me?
"Is that so?"
An Qisheng's eyes flickered slightly: "Then what do you want?"
His voice was calm, but as he spoke lightly, an aura so powerful that it was impossible to look at directly, an aura that no one could ignore, instantly filled the entire world.
Li Feibai and the others felt their bodies shake and scrambled away to the side of the mountain temple.
"I, Feng, have studied the sword since the age of eight, and it has been sixty years since then. I believe my swordsmanship is not inferior to others! Today, having the opportunity to meet Mr. An, who is ranked second on the Earthly List, I naturally want to seek some guidance..."
Feng Zhenzong's expression was calm, his words straightforward as the long sword in his hand slowly rose:
"This is the Vertical and Horizontal Seventeen Swords that I created. I invite Mr. An to critique them!"
Even as his words faded, the night suddenly brightened!
The snow-white sword light, like a bolt of silk, was dazzling as soon as it appeared, like mercury pouring down, flooding into the drafty mountain temple!
Zheng zheng zheng~
First came the sword light, then the sound of the sword reverberated.
Vertical!
Horizontal!
The sword light scattered in all directions, illuminating the dim night, but within that sky-filled sword light, there were only two sword beams, one vertical and one horizontal!
The two sword beams intersected like a cross, containing boundless sharpness.
Wherever they passed, the dust that rose, the cobwebs that hung down, the broken wooden door, and even the ubiquitous airflow were all cut and shattered into countless tiny, invisible fragments.
Whoosh whoosh~~
The extremely sharp and cold light illuminated An Qisheng's eyes.
At that moment, Tie Shan, who was sitting to the side, seemed to see an endless starry sky in those eyes, vast, deep, and immeasurable.
An Qisheng slowly reached out his hand, his five fingers gently clenched, and in the sound of his bones and joints popping, a long spear appeared from nowhere and was grasped in his palm.
Without any exquisite movements, he simply thrust it out horizontally with a slight movement of his arm.
This spear was not exquisite; there were no sky-filled spear shadows or intricate changes, but just a simple thrust made the expressions of the three men outside the mountain temple change.
Especially Feng Zhenzong, who bore the brunt of the attack, felt as if he was seeing endless, towering mountains moving towards him!
Under the unparalleled, immense force, even though it was just a single spear thrust, it seemed to push all the airflow in the mountain temple out along with it!
The sky-filled sword force collided with the spear and instantly collapsed and disintegrated.
Boom!
Only then did the sound waves and airflow howl and roar!
The air seemed to become a surface of water, rippling in layers and spreading in all directions.
The abruptly surging sound waves and air currents exploded and roared like a string of firecrackers!
In just an instant, the dust and gravel that had accumulated in the mountain temple for countless years roared out, like countless hidden weapons covering the sky and heading towards the three men.
Crack crack crack~
The dilapidated mountain temple groaned, as if it might collapse at any moment.
"This kind of power is even more domineering than Yun Tang!"
After the initial collision, Feng Zhenzong was shocked.
Seeing the dust and air currents rolling towards him like dragons, he had no time to think. The True Qi within his body erupted instantly, reaching the trembling sword tip in the face of such great force.
Buzz~
The sword light was like a waterfall, instantly submerging the rolling dust dragon.
Then, the unfinished sword flashed and leaped out again, its speed even faster, its boundless sharpness about to burst forth between vertical and horizontal strikes!
"Mr. An, Yun has some skill in fists and palms, please guide me as well!"
Before Feng Zhenzong could strike a second time, Yun Tang had already roared like thunder.
With booming sound waves, his surging True Qi shattered the rolling dust and gravel as he thrust out his palm.
Then, his body followed his palm, shooting straight into the mountain temple.
His physique was strong, and a single squeeze shattered the howling airflow. When his powerful palm struck, it stacked upon itself before the previous strike had even finished!
In an instant, he had already stacked seven layers of palm force!
What kind of ferocious palm force was this, unleashed with all his might and stacked seven times?
The vast True Qi was continuous and unceasing, surging like the great waves of the Yangtze River!
In just an instant, all the dust in the sky had been blasted away, and the entire mountain temple shook, as if it had jumped up from its foundations deep underground!
"Mr. An, forgive me!"
With the two men attacking one after another, Dong Tianyou naturally couldn't stand by.
At the moment Yun Tang thrust out his palm, his True Qi also erupted.
His five fingers were seen extending and pointing like a sword directly at the mountain temple, and his True Qi surged out wildly.
Buzz~
As he pointed, the long sword on his back seemed to come to life, leaping up from behind him like a swallow returning to its nest. It followed his sword finger, like a flying sword, cutting through the dark night sky.
Like a flying sword, it instantly disappeared into the night, piercing straight towards the mountain temple.
He was known as "A Line Across Ten Thousand Miles" because his sword was so fast!
Although he attacked last, his flying sword would still pierce into the mountain temple before the other two!
It seemed that even sound was left behind, and with just a flash, it had already pierced through the layers of airflow and squeezed into the three-foot area between An Qisheng's eyebrows!
The three great masters attacked simultaneously, with great momentum, as if a sure kill!
